WebMar 26, 2024 · ABSTRACTGalvanized steel pipe is a very common material used in domestic water systems, primarily for larger pipe diameters (DN 50 or 80 (NPS 2 or 3) and above) due to the expense of copper pipe. While galvanized pipe is allowed in most building codes, it has corrosion issues when used for hot, softened water service. One wrench holds ... WebOct 6, 2024 · To recycle rusted metal, you need to remove the oxygen again. In the recycling process for steel, the material is shredded and then melted to create new sheets of metal. If the rust is simply melted, it will re-form once the metal cools.

WebMar 13, 2024 · Galvanizing piping is the process of coating steel or iron with a protective layer of zinc. The goal is to help prevent corrosion.
